Abstract (EN)

In this thesis, we have studied bacterial fish disease as MotileAeromonas Septicemia caused by A. hydrophila, A. veronii, A. caviae and A.sobria in Rainbow trout at Mugla (Fethiye) region.Fish samples have been collected and carried out in cold and sterileconditions from rainbow trout farm as the fish showes symptones ofdiseases. The bacterial samples have been collected from different tisues andincubated in steril medium. DNA isolates was made from those samples todetect pathogen gene related to Motile Aeromonas Septicemia. We haveselected Aero gene and OmpTS gene from A. hydrophila, tet gene from A.veronii, F3-B3 gene from A. caviae and AH gene from A. sobria to detectbacteria. PCR was optimised and samples were electrophoresed.As a result of this study, A. hydrophila, A. veronii, A. caviae and A.sobria has seen as positive PCR results in liver and kidney tissue.
